Anatomy is a 2016 horror video game developed by Kitty Horrorshow. [1] It was released on PC, MAC OS X, and Linux. [2]

Reception

The game is considered to be a cult classic. [3] It has received positive reviews from critics. [4] Julie Muncy of Wired wrote that "Anatomy is a powerful entry point to [horror] experience, an explanation of its value and an exploration of its impact. Haunted houses are having a moment, but the best ones, pound for pound, might be in video games. And in terms of succinct power and lasting impact, Anatomy can't be beat." [5] Steven Messner, writing for Rock, Paper, Shotgun, said "It's a curious thing that Anatomy is so effective, because in reality it's a pretty janky Unity game set inside of a small home that you simply walk around and explore."
